Verapaz Express, located at 1869 Cottman Ave in Philadelphia, operates under the official business category of a travel agency. However, a closer examination reveals a business model that is far more specialized and community-focused than the general label suggests. Based on its name—Verapaz being a well-known department in Guatemala—and its services, this establishment functions as a vital hub for the Guatemalan and broader Central American community in the region. While it does handle travel arrangements, its primary strengths and unique offerings extend into package delivery, money transfers, and nostalgic goods, making it a multifaceted service provider. This deep specialization is its greatest asset, but it also defines its limitations for the average traveler.

A Deep Dive into Services: More Than Just Travel

The name "Verapaz Express" itself provides the first clue to its business focus. Research confirms that the agency is deeply rooted in connecting the Guatemalan diaspora in the United States with their home country. While clients can likely arrange flight booking and other travel-related services, the company's own marketing and online presence heavily emphasize its role in "encomiendas," or package shipping. They specialize in reliably sending and receiving parcels between the U.S. and Guatemala, positioning themselves as a secure and efficient courier. This is a critical service for families looking to send goods, gifts, and essential items back home. The business also offers shipping for a variety of nostalgic products, including traditional foods like bread, sweets, and even prepared meals, allowing community members to share a taste of home with relatives.

Beyond logistics, Verapaz Express provides secure remittance services through partners like Vigo Money Transfer and Maxi-MS, facilitating fast and reliable money transfers. This suite of services—travel, shipping, and money transfers—paints a picture of a business that understands the specific needs of its immigrant clientele. It's not just a place to book a flight; it's a comprehensive support center for maintaining transnational family ties. According to their website, they are a "chapín team dedicated to uniting Guatemalan families in the U.S.", which clearly states their mission. This mission-driven approach is a significant positive, as it fosters a sense of trust and community that larger, more impersonal corporations often lack.
